About

Mojtaba Akhavan‐Tafti is a scholar working on Astronomy and Astrophysics, Molecular Biology and Geophysics. According to data from OpenAlex, Mojtaba Akhavan‐Tafti has authored 19 papers receiving a total of 315 ind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Astronomy and Astrophysics, 10 papers in Molecular Biology and 3 papers in Geophysics. Recurrent topics in Mojtaba Akhavan‐Tafti’s work include Ionosphere and magnetosphere dynamics (19 papers), Solar and Space Plasma Dynamics (16 papers) and Geomagnetism and Paleomagnetism Studies (10 papers). Mojtaba Akhavan‐Tafti is often cited by papers focused on Ionosphere and magnetosphere dynamics (19 papers), Solar and Space Plasma Dynamics (16 papers) and Geomagnetism and Paleomagnetism Studies (10 papers). Mojtaba Akhavan‐Tafti collaborates with scholars based in United States, France and United Kingdom. Mojtaba Akhavan‐Tafti's co-authors include J. A. Slavin, D. J. Gershman, W. Sun, G. Le, B. L. Giles, J. L. Burch, J. P. Eastwood, P. A. Cassak, R. B. Torbert and C. T. Russell and has published in prestigious journals such as The Astrophysical Journal, Geophysical Research Letters and Astronomy and Astrophysics.
